Gun metal has been a trusted engineering alloy for decades. Known for its balanced combination of strength, corrosion resistance, and excellent machinability, it is commonly used in pump housings, valves, marine fittings, and heavy duty equipment. Industrial gun metal bushes perform exceptionally well in environments exposed to moisture, pressure, and mechanical stress.

Industrial buyers often assess bush performance based on load bearing capability, wear resistance, and dimensional consistency. Even a slight variation in tolerance can affect machine alignment, which is why precision becomes crucial in bush manufacturing.

Another reason industries prefer gun metal bushes is their adaptability. These components work effectively in applications where lubrication may be inconsistent or operational loads vary frequently. From hydraulic systems to industrial machinery, gun metal bushes help maintain stable and reliable mechanical performance.
